Click for Lucia

One of Deerfield’s own, Caruso Middle School sixth grader Lucia Ruiz, was severely injured in the Spanish train crash July 24. Friends have set up a website to help defray the costs of two broken legs, a cracked skill, internal bleeding and more. You can help by clicking here for Lucia.

Keep Boiling Your Water

Deerfield’s boil order remains in effect through at least midday Wednesday. Keep bringing water to a boil, keep it there for at least a minute and then let it cool before using. Travel to the Moon

Well, not exactly. But, the Lake County Astronomical Society will bring strong enough telescopes at 7 p.m. Wednesday at Jewett Park to see the mountains and craters on the moon. The event is sponsored by the Deerfield Public Library and is free.
